Attraction Co-President Amy Arriaga’s Passion for Show Choir Takes the Stage 

by Eva Pearson

What do you do as Co-President of Attraction?

I try to make sure that everybody in the group feels included and that they’re staying on task. I am also trying to make a fun and positive environment this year with everybody…even though it already is! My goal is to make the girls in Attraction feel comfortable with one another and that they always have someone to go to if they need something. Other than that, I help plan events and run the GroupMe. 

What other choirs are you a part of this year?

I am also in Chambers, which is a concert choir. You have to at least have one year of experience in a concert or show choir beforehand. Previously, I was also a part of Allegros. 

What made you want to join show choir in the first place?

I have always had a passion for singing! Since I was little, I have always been singing. I would always try to overpower my sister’s singing when we were in the car, picked to do choir in intermediate school, and since then have tried to be a part of any choir program I could be a part of. 

What is one of the most memorable moments you have of being in show choir?

During our Plainfield competition last year, during warm-ups, Mr. Stainbrook used it to hype us up. We were all dancing to our show songs, but we weren’t doing our actual choreography. We were all just getting loose and having fun! Stainbrook was new that year too, so it really made a good first impression for him. 

Do you have a favorite show you’ve performed in?

During my freshman year we did our “School Girls and Ghosts” show and it was just so creative. It was honestly the first time I had ever seen any show like it and we did lots of iconic songs like “Bump in the Night” and “Thriller” that were all so fun to sing and dance to.

What is one piece of advice/words of wisdom you would give to your underclassmen show choir peers?

Give everything you do 100%, even if you feel like you’re embarrassing yourself. It’s okay to make mistakes and we are all human. 

How are you feeling about your upcoming show for Attraction?

I am feeling really good about it! Our opening song will hit the audience and personally I have never done anything like this show in all four years competing. Let’s just say that we will be making some really cool sounds that will merge together to form a really cool beat. 

What is your dream song to perform?

I would say “Colors of the Wind” because that song means a lot to me. My dad loves that song, and he played it throughout my whole childhood so I would love to sing it on stage one day. 

If you were able to join every choir at AHS, would you?

Honestly, yes. I would have loved to be in Allegros again this year, but I did not have room for it in my schedule because it really pushed my musical knowledge. Concert choir and show choir just have a hold on my heart, but to join every single choir would just be a lot of work. If I had the time and space in my schedule I would join as many as I could.
